The bases from one strand form hydrogen bonds with the bases on the other strand. Adenine forms two H-bonds with thymine. Cytosine forms three H-bonds with guanine.

Sulfur oxides combine with water to produce sulfuric acid but not nitro acids. Nitro acids are a product of nitrogen oxides reacting with water.

No. Nitro engines are a two cycle engine that are specifically designed to run on specialized nitro mixes. Most gasoline engines are more complex four cycle engines. If you use the wrong fuel in either type of engine, it could ruin your expensive equipment.
